Description
GABA 300MG Capsule contains gabapentin as its active ingredient. Gabapentin is an anticonvulsant medication used to treat various neurological conditions.
Primary Uses
GABA 300 is prescribed for:
- Neuropathic pain: Effective in managing nerve pain from conditions such as diabetic neuropathy, shingles (postherpetic neuralgia), and spinal cord injuries.
- Epilepsy: Used as adjunctive therapy for partial seizures in adults and children aged 3 years and older.
- Restless Legs Syndrome (RLS): Helps relieve discomfort and improve sleep quality in individuals with RLS.
- Off-label uses: Sometimes prescribed for anxiety disorders, fibromyalgia, and other chronic pain conditions at the doctor’s discretion.
How It Works
Gabapentin works by binding to specific calcium channels in the brain and spinal cord. This helps stabilize electrical nerve activity and reduces the release of excitatory neurotransmitters, thereby easing nerve pain and controlling seizures.
Dosage & Administration
- Initial dosing typically starts at 300 mg once daily.
- The dose may be gradually increased depending on the condition and patient response.
- Capsules should be swallowed whole with water, with or without food. Do not crush or chew.
- It’s important to take this medicine consistently, even if symptoms improve.
Potential Side Effects
Common side effects include:
- Dizziness
- Drowsiness
- Fatigue
- Nausea
- Peripheral edema (swelling in limbs)
These effects are usually mild and tend to reduce over time as the body adjusts to the medication.
Warnings & Precautions
- Mental health: Monitor for mood changes, depression, or suicidal thoughts.
- Drug interactions: Gabapentin can interact with medications like morphine, increasing side effects.
- Pregnancy: Use during pregnancy only under medical advice.
